Paul P Posted December 27, 2023 Report Share Posted December 27, 2023 34 minutes ago, bally4563 said: What lead do I need from the head unit to a smart phone ? Thanks What type of phone ? If it’s an iPhone then usb a to lightning. If Samsung /android ( as a guess) usb a to micro usb or newer phones may be usb a to usb c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

cozzykim Posted December 27, 2023 Report Share Posted December 27, 2023 (edited) There should be a flying lead in the glove box with a USB-A socket on the end of it. Mine's a '13 plate with satnav and DAB but there are various versions. P.S. I'm just oop't road from you. EDIT: The slot in your pic is for a SIM card to use the PCM as a car phone.
